Summary

Significance of the Topic


Accurate wastewater analysis relies on high-quality chemical standards to ensure regulatory compliance, method validation, and reproducible results. Agilent’s portfolio of certified reference materials and quality control standards addresses the growing need for comprehensive solutions across a broad range of EPA methods, enabling laboratories to meet stringent environmental monitoring requirements.

Goals and Overview


This white paper catalogs Agilent’s ULTRA chemical standards tailored for wastewater analysis. It presents ready-to-use mixtures, internal and surrogate spiking solutions, and custom formulations designed to support EPA Methods 601 through 1664A. The document also outlines Agilent’s certification framework, market focus, and custom product services.

Methodology and Instrumentation


Production and validation of standards follow a rigorous quality management system including:
  • ISO 9001: Quality management across manufacturing
  • ISO 17025: Accredited QC laboratory for analytical characterization
  • ISO Guide 34: Reference material production with homogeneity and stability testing

Analytical workflows covered by Agilent standards encompass:
  • Purge-and-trap GC/ECD and GC/MS for volatile organics (EPA 601, 602, 624)
  • GC/FID and derivatization protocols for phenols, haloethers, and herbicides (EPA 604, 611, 615)
  • GC/NPD and GC/FPD for pesticides and nitrosamines (EPA 603, 607, 614, 619, 622)
  • Capillary GC/MS for PCBs and dioxins (EPA 613, 680)
  • HPLC-EC and HPLC-fluorescence for benzidines and PAHs (EPA 605, 610)
  • Gravimetric extraction and Kuderna-Danish concentration for semi-volatiles and oil & grease (EPA 606, 632, 1311, 1664)

Key Results and Discussion


Agilent offers over 7,000 standards, including:
  • EPA-specified multi-analyte mixtures for volatile organics, phenols, pesticides, PCBs, and extractables
  • Individual internal and surrogate standards for accurate recovery monitoring
  • Custom reference materials at three validation levels with traceability and uncertainty data
  • Triple certification (ISO 9001, ISO 17025, ISO Guide 34) assuring product integrity

The pre-formulated kits and spiking solutions simplify method setup, reduce preparation time, and improve consistency across laboratories.
